FAQ

Common Spiders Extermination Questions

What types of spiders are commonly treated? Treatments typically target common household spiders such as cobweb spiders, orb weavers, and wolf spiders found in Frisco homes.

Where do spiders usually hide in properties? Spiders often hide in dark corners, basements, attics, behind furniture, and around window and door frames.

How can property owners prevent future spider infestations? Regular cleaning, sealing cracks and gaps, and removing clutter around the property can help reduce spider habitats.
